From e24ddb910693163e8a932e7fa89c2a26afc56bff Mon Sep 17 00:00:00 2001 From: arkon Date: Tue, 28 Apr 2020 23:03:30 -0400 Subject: [PATCH] Use same header layout for sources/extensions/migration --- .../ui/browse/extension/ExtensionGroupHolder.kt | 2 +- .../ui/browse/extension/ExtensionGroupItem.kt | 2 +- .../tachiyomi/ui/browse/source/LangHolder.kt | 2 +- .../tachiyomi/ui/browse/source/LangItem.kt | 2 +- .../tachiyomi/ui/migration/SelectionHeader.kt | 4 ++-- .../main/res/layout/extension_controller.xml | 2 +- .../main/res/layout/source_main_controller.xml | 2 +- .../res/layout/source_main_controller_card.xml | 17 ----------------- ...l => source_main_controller_card_header.xml} | 0 9 files changed, 8 insertions(+), 25 deletions(-) delete mode 100644 app/src/main/res/layout/source_main_controller_card.xml rename app/src/main/res/layout/{extension_card_header.xml => source_main_controller_card_header.xml} (100%) diff --git a/app/src/main/java/eu/kanade/tachiyomi/ui/browse/extension/ExtensionGroupHolder.kt b/app/src/main/java/eu/kanade/tachiyomi/ui/browse/extension/ExtensionGroupHolder.kt index fdea10157..2712a4ee1 100644 --- a/app/src/main/java/eu/kanade/tachiyomi/ui/browse/extension/ExtensionGroupHolder.kt +++ b/app/src/main/java/eu/kanade/tachiyomi/ui/browse/extension/ExtensionGroupHolder.kt @@ -4,7 +4,7 @@ import android.annotation.SuppressLint import android.view.View import eu.davidea.flexibleadapter.FlexibleAdapter import eu.kanade.tachiyomi.ui.base.holder.BaseFlexibleViewHolder -import kotlinx.android.synthetic.main.extension_card_header.title +import kotlinx.android.synthetic.main.source_main_controller_card_header.title class ExtensionGroupHolder(view: View, adapter: FlexibleAdapter<*>) : BaseFlexibleViewHolder(view, adapter) { diff --git a/app/src/main/java/eu/kanade/tachiyomi/ui/browse/extension/ExtensionGroupItem.kt b/app/src/main/java/eu/kanade/tachiyomi/ui/browse/extension/ExtensionGroupItem.kt index 8c65ea225..6e235f91c 100644 --- a/app/src/main/java/eu/kanade/tachiyomi/ui/browse/extension/ExtensionGroupItem.kt +++ b/app/src/main/java/eu/kanade/tachiyomi/ui/browse/extension/ExtensionGroupItem.kt @@ -19,7 +19,7 @@ data class ExtensionGroupItem(val name: String, val size: Int, val showSize: Boo * Returns the layout resource of this item. */ override fun getLayoutRes(): Int { - return R.layout.extension_card_header + return R.layout.source_main_controller_card_header } /** diff --git a/app/src/main/java/eu/kanade/tachiyomi/ui/browse/source/LangHolder.kt b/app/src/main/java/eu/kanade/tachiyomi/ui/browse/source/LangHolder.kt index c0da896c3..d62ccd601 100644 --- a/app/src/main/java/eu/kanade/tachiyomi/ui/browse/source/LangHolder.kt +++ b/app/src/main/java/eu/kanade/tachiyomi/ui/browse/source/LangHolder.kt @@ -4,7 +4,7 @@ import android.view.View import eu.davidea.flexibleadapter.FlexibleAdapter import eu.kanade.tachiyomi.ui.base.holder.BaseFlexibleViewHolder import eu.kanade.tachiyomi.util.system.LocaleHelper -import kotlinx.android.synthetic.main.source_main_controller_card.title +import kotlinx.android.synthetic.main.source_main_controller_card_header.title class LangHolder(view: View, adapter: FlexibleAdapter<*>) : BaseFlexibleViewHolder(view, adapter) { diff --git a/app/src/main/java/eu/kanade/tachiyomi/ui/browse/source/LangItem.kt b/app/src/main/java/eu/kanade/tachiyomi/ui/browse/source/LangItem.kt index fe0e6b389..189c1c41d 100644 --- a/app/src/main/java/eu/kanade/tachiyomi/ui/browse/source/LangItem.kt +++ b/app/src/main/java/eu/kanade/tachiyomi/ui/browse/source/LangItem.kt @@ -18,7 +18,7 @@ data class LangItem(val code: String) : AbstractHeaderItem() { * Returns the layout resource of this item. */ override fun getLayoutRes(): Int { - return R.layout.source_main_controller_card + return R.layout.source_main_controller_card_header } /** diff --git a/app/src/main/java/eu/kanade/tachiyomi/ui/migration/SelectionHeader.kt b/app/src/main/java/eu/kanade/tachiyomi/ui/migration/SelectionHeader.kt index 196cfb1ca..9530c68bc 100644 --- a/app/src/main/java/eu/kanade/tachiyomi/ui/migration/SelectionHeader.kt +++ b/app/src/main/java/eu/kanade/tachiyomi/ui/migration/SelectionHeader.kt @@ -7,7 +7,7 @@ import eu.davidea.flexibleadapter.items.AbstractHeaderItem import eu.davidea.flexibleadapter.items.IFlexible import eu.kanade.tachiyomi.R import eu.kanade.tachiyomi.ui.base.holder.BaseFlexibleViewHolder -import kotlinx.android.synthetic.main.source_main_controller_card.title +import kotlinx.android.synthetic.main.source_main_controller_card_header.title /** * Item that contains the selection header. @@ -18,7 +18,7 @@ class SelectionHeader : AbstractHeaderItem() { * Returns the layout resource of this item. */ override fun getLayoutRes(): Int { - return R.layout.source_main_controller_card + return R.layout.source_main_controller_card_header } /** diff --git a/app/src/main/res/layout/extension_controller.xml b/app/src/main/res/layout/extension_controller.xml index 348b616c3..eedf561d9 100644 --- a/app/src/main/res/layout/extension_controller.xml +++ b/app/src/main/res/layout/extension_controller.xml @@ -14,7 +14,7 @@ android:id="@+id/ext_recycler" android:layout_width="match_parent" android:layout_height="wrap_content" - tools:listitem="@layout/extension_card_header" /> + tools:listitem="@layout/source_main_controller_card_header" /> diff --git a/app/src/main/res/layout/source_main_controller.xml b/app/src/main/res/layout/source_main_controller.xml index 24eac6624..7ce5a6140 100644 --- a/app/src/main/res/layout/source_main_controller.xml +++ b/app/src/main/res/layout/source_main_controller.xml @@ -9,7 +9,7 @@ android:id="@+id/recycler" android:layout_width="match_parent" android:layout_height="wrap_content" - tools:listitem="@layout/source_main_controller_card" /> + tools:listitem="@layout/source_main_controller_card_header" /> - - - - - diff --git a/app/src/main/res/layout/extension_card_header.xml b/app/src/main/res/layout/source_main_controller_card_header.xml similarity index 100% rename from app/src/main/res/layout/extension_card_header.xml rename to app/src/main/res/layout/source_main_controller_card_header.xml